Abstract

An energy assisted magnetic recording (EAMR) transducer having an air-bearing surface (ABS) is described. The EAMR transducer includes at least one near-field transducer (NFT) and an electronic lapping guide (ELG) substantially coplanar with a portion of the at least one film. In some aspects, the NFT includes a disk portion and a pin portion. The pin is between the disk portion and the ABS. The pin portion corresponds to a critical dimension of the NFT from an ABS location.
